KEY RESPONSIBILITIES
- This role will work directly with the Production Control Group Leader to ensure an effective strategy is executed. This will require:
- Place purchase orders with suppliers for the procurement of production material as required by forecast and production schedule
- Monitor status of open purchase orders to ensure on-time delivery of all materials, including timely resolution, communication and mitigation of future potential problems
- Expedite or defer orders as required based on schedule/inventory changes
- Run Kanban extracts daily in PFEP to trigger order and releases to suppliers
- Ensure optimal levels and safety stock are maintained for their parts
- Transact as necessary in SAP system to ensure inventory accuracy which includes extract scans to SAP and suppliers
- Cycle count locally sources parts and make SAP inventory adjustments as necessary
- Audits Kanban process to ensure adherence to standard
- Execute stock transfer for China kit parts from Parts and Service Inventory
